Early adhesion induces interaction of FAK and Fyn in lipid domains and activates raft-dependent Akt signaling in SW480 colon cancer cells

Abstract: Integrin-dependent interaction of epithelial tumor cells with extracellular matrix (ECM) is critical for their migration, but also for hematogenous dissemination. Elevated expression and activity of Src family kinases (SFKs) in colon cancer cells is often required in the disease progression. In this work, we highlighted how focal adhesion kinase (FAK) and SFKs interacted and we analyzed how PI3K/Akt and MAPK/Erk1/2 signaling pathways were activated in early stages of colon cancer cell adhesion. “…Within the lipid raft, Fyn phosphorylates FAK at Y861 and Y925, which leads to the reversed translocation of FAK out of the lipid rafts and thereby activation of the PI3K/Akt pathway. In colon cancer cells (SW480), the Fyn-FAK interaction induces a lipid raft-dependent 'short-term' effect (the activation of the PI3K/Akt pathway) and a lipid raft-independent 'long-term' effect (the activation of the MAPK-Erk1/2 pathway) [33]. Both signaling pathways reinforce the adhesion of cancer cells.…”
